Join the Marine Institute as an Instructor for the School of Fisheries, covering essential programs across Newfoundland, Nunavut, and the Northwest Territories. Shape the future of maritime training with your expertise. As an instructor, you will guide students through various courses, including advanced fishing certifications and Bridge watch training. Travel opportunities within the regions are essential for course delivery and student engagement.
Key Responsibilities Deliver training in Fishing Masters IV and other courses
Prepare students for Bridge watch exams with hands‑on instruction
Maintain training records and assess student needs
Travel frequently for course delivery across provinces
Develop communication and maritime skills of students
Requirements Valid Fishing Masters IV or equivalent qualifications
Minimum Watchkeeping Mate Certificate required
Excellent oral, written, and IT skills
Proven ability to lead and work collaboratively
Previous experience in post‑secondary instruction is beneficial
